About Tales.com

Tales turns your loved one’s stories into a professional, private podcast. Tales has professional interviewers who speak with your loved one to uncover the stories you never knew. Then the conversation gets edited into a professionally-produced, private podcast episode that your family will cherish forever.

Capture your loved ones' voices for future generations! I commissioned Tales interviews with 4 members of our older generation - my Mother, Aunts and an Uncle. Each person decided how many interviews they would be comfortable doing. They ranged from 1 interview to 5 interviews. Each person had a positive experience with the interview. The interviews have been shared broadly to our family of cousins, nieces and nephews. I have to say they have been terrific, and I highly recommend commissioning interviews with anyone over 60 now rather than later when health issues may become an issue. I wish I had found Tales before my father passed away 2 years ago. I learned so much that I did not know from each person interviewed. Some was personal history and some was local history of the town that I grew up in that I did not know. All of the interviews were done well. I recommend having good internet connection for the Zoom interviews for the best sound quality. If your family members think they do not have anything that people want to hear, come up with some questions for them so they know their stories are valued. I highly recommend taking the leap to get the interview process started. My husband loved the idea so much he has gifted the Life Story - 5 interviews to his father. He only wishes he had known about Tales before his mother passed away 2 years ago.
